使用我的应用程序中的注册用户自动登录到 Skype for business online

Auto login using registered users in my application to Skype for business online

我有一个场景,其中 Web 应用程序使用 MYSQL 数据库来存储注册用户。此 Web 应用程序与 Skype for business Online (Web SDK) 集成,可以通过音频、视频、聊天等方式相互交流。

我正在实现这样一种功能,即所有注册用户(在 MYSQL 中)都应该能够自动访问 Skype Web SDK,而无需要求他们提供 O 365 凭据。因为用户已经注册了我的应用程序,所以要求他们向 Skype 服务提供 O365 凭据不是一个好主意。

所以我想构建这样一种功能,当注册用户 (MYSQL) 点击 'Audio Call' 时,在后台会自动发生三件事。 1.Creation O 365 中的用户(如果不存在),2. 使用 O 365 凭据登录,3. 开始音频通话。

这是否可以通过 Skype web SDK(在线)实现?

我是 Skype for business online 的新手,如果有其他可用的方式,请提出建议。 并让我了解可用的 Web API,以使用租户的全局管理员批量创建 O 365 帐户。

目前,这是不可能的。对于授权用户,必须将浏览器导航到 Microsoft 域以对用户进行身份验证并生成访问令牌。只有在那之后,您的用户才能被授权,用户才能登录 Skype 服务。